Jordan is tracking a recent online purchase. The shipping costs state that the item will be shipped in a 24-inch long box with a volume of 2,880 cubic inches. The width of the box is seven inches less than the height. What is a cuboid?

A cuboid is a three-dimensional closed figure which has volume along with surface area.

The volume of a cuboid is the product of its length, width, and height.

The total surface area of a cuboid is 2( lw + wh + wl) and the lateral surface area is 2(l + w)×h.

Given, The width of the box is seven inches less than the height.

Assuming the width to be 'w' hence the height(h) = w + 7 and has a length of 24 inches with a volume of 2880 cubic inches.

We know the volume(V) of a cuboid is l×w×h.

Therefore,

24×w×(w + 7) = 2880.

24w(w + 7) = 2880.

24w² + 168w = 2880.

6w² + 42w = 720.

w² + 7w = 120.

w² + 7w - 120 = 0.

w² + 15w - 8w - 120 = 0.

w(w + 15) - 8(w + 15) = 0.

(w + 15)(w - 8) = 0.

w = 8 and hence h = 8 = 7 = 15.

So, the width and height of the box is 8 and 15 inches respectively.

Which complex number has a distance of the square root of 17 from the origin on the complex plane?

Answers

OVERVIEW

A complex number is a real number combined with an imaginary number (such as i, a number that will equal -1 when squared).

The complex plane is an interesting thing we use to graph complex numbers. The horizontal axis is where you plot the real part of the complex number, and the y-axis is where you plot the coefficient of the imaginary number.

For example, if I had the complex number 4+3i, I would plot the point (4,3) on the complex plane.

-------------------------------------------------------------------

MODULI

The modulus (plural is moduli) is the distance of a complex number from the origin on the complex plane. To find the modulus, you take the real number and the coefficient (basically the points of your graph), square them, add the results, and then you find the square root of that! Here's a little checklist so that you can always find the modulus of any complex number!

STEPS TO FIND MODULUS GIVEN COMPLEX NUMBER

STEP 1: PLOT THE COMPLEX NUMBER

Let's use our complex number 4+3i. If we plot it, the point will be (4,3)

STEP 2: TAKE YOUR VALUES OF X AND Y AND SQUARE THEM

4²=16

3²=9

STEP 3: ADD THESE SQUARES

16+9=25

STEP 4: SQUARE ROOT IT

√25=5

Therefore, the modulus (distance from the origin on the complex plane) of 4+3i is 5.
